Developing Neural Memory Agents: A Comprehensive Approach with Differentiable Memory, Meta-Learning, and Experience Replay for Continuous Adaptation in Dynamic Environments – MarkTechPost

Explore a groundbreaking coding implementation designed to develop neural memory agents utilizing differentiable memory, meta-learning, and experience replay. This innovative approach enables continual adaptation in dynamic environments, making it a significant advancement in artificial intelligence. By leveraging differentiable memory, these agents can improve their performance over time, learning from past experiences while navigating changes in their surroundings. The integration of meta-learning facilitates the ability to adapt to new tasks efficiently, enhancing the agents’ versatility. Experience replay further strengthens their learning by allowing the retention and re-evaluation of past interactions. This combination of techniques positions neural memory agents at the forefront of AI development, promising enhanced adaptability and efficiency in various applications.
